Jan-June rice exports see slight increase, top $1 billion
Cambodia exported nearly 3.6 million tonnes of paddy and milled rice in the first half of 2025, generating over $1 billion in revenue, an increase of nearly 7% compared to the same period in 2024. Currently, 50 exporters are actively exporting Cambodian milled rice. ...

Giant steps: Footwear exports up 40% in first five months of year
Cambodia’s footwear export industry generated nearly $850 million in revenue during the first five months of 2025, an increase of almost 40% over the same period last year. The US accounted for more than one-third of the total export value. ...
